National Latino AIDS Awareness Day
October 15 is National Latino AIDS Awareness Day.
The Latino Commission on AIDS (LCOA) , the Hispanic Federation and many other organizations organize this day. The NLAAD campaign works annually at building capacity for non-profit organizations and health departments in order to reach Latino/Hispanic communities, promote HIV testing, provide HIV prevention information and access to care.
